At 26 years old, Biles made an incredible comeback, dominating the routines with her signature flair. She realized her long-held dream of an eighth all-around title, moving it from 2021 to this year’s US Championships. However, what wasn’t easy for the four-time Olympic gold medalist was handling the mounting pressure. In an exclusive interview with @TODAYshow, host Hoda Kotb asked a series of questions posted on their Twitter. Just like everyone, Kotb said, “You dove right in, Was that your strategy going in?”

Biles smiled and replied, “I think we have to be a little bit more cautious about how we do things.” The conversation was easy yet detailed, the gymnast said, “Everything we are doing leading up to this game has been intentional.” Finally, giving away her strategy that went down in the Nationals, she said, “We kinda have been playing on the down low this time making sure mentally and physically are both intact.”

After she won her place as the reigning all-around in the team, Biles shared that a federation member told her she was their “gold-medal token.” During the Tokyo Olympics, truly nothing worked right for Biles. Soon after receiving the remark, Biles’ anxiety rose and added nervousness, endangering her physical safety. It was a natural fall into the twisties.

She withdrew from the team competition and the finals of four individual events pulling herself from the situation. Later, Li Li Leung, president and CEO of USA Gymnastics, expressed disappointment upon learning about the unfortunate incident. Leung said, ” I can assure you that we do not condone that conduct.”
